When I was working, some of our jobs were structural strengthening with carbon fiber. The resin we used required that we make a paste out of it. You could mix it as thick or thin as you wanted.
This is what we used as a thickener. Cabot Cab-o-sil Amorphous Fumed Silica. It's about $140.00 for a 10lb. bag. The bag is huge as the material is very light. This stuff will get all over everything if care is not taken. If the Carbon fiber was to be painted it had to be 100% acrylic paint. The epoxy we used was over $400.00 per kit. I don't think you want to use that. I would think the Cab-o-sil would work with any epoxy.
